    The History of Turner Network Television

    Back in the day, when cable TV was still finding its footing, Ted Turner came onto the scene with a vision. In 1988, Turner Network Television was born, and it wasn't just another channel—it was a statement. Ted Turner, the media mogul with a knack for innovation, saw potential where others saw limitations. He wanted to create a network that would redefine what television could be.

    At first, TNT focused heavily on classic movies and sports programming. It was a place where you could catch some of the greatest films ever made and stay updated on the world of boxing. But as the years went by, the network evolved. It started experimenting with original programming, and boy, did it pay off. Shows like "The Closer" and "Rizzoli & Isles" became household names, and TNT became synonymous with quality entertainment.

    Take "The Closer," for example. This show about a no-nonsense detective who solves cases with her unique methods became a sensation. It wasn't just about the plotlines; it was about the characters, the depth, and the relatability. And then there's "Rizzoli & Isles," which brought a fresh take on crime dramas by focusing on the dynamic between two strong female leads.
